About

Fashion Photographer who first began working with British Vogue magazine in 1960.

Before Fame

He worked as a photographic assistant for the John French Studio.

Trivia

He was the Photographer for a special edition of GQ magazine in 2005, featuring British Musicians Jarvis Cocker and Belle & Sebastian.

Family Life

He married his second wife, Catherine Dyer, in 1986. He has children named Fenton, Sascha, and Paloma.

Associated With

The film Blowup, directed by Michelangelo Antonioni, is loosely based on Bailey's life.
